Key Features
- Tac-Stretch Fabric: Provides improved range of movement so kneeling, climbing, and quick motion feel less restrictive during activity.
- Quick Utility Pockets: A tactical pocket layout gives fast access to tools and essentials while keeping contents organized on the move.
- Comfort Elastic Waistband: The adjustable waist fit adds midday comfort and accommodates light layering without needing a belt.
- Reinforced Structure: Double-stitching at stress points improves durability so the pants stand up to repeated abrasion and heavy wear.
- Water Resistant Ripstop: Lightweight ripstop resists light moisture and reduces tearing for outdoor tasks and unpredictable weather.
Who It's For
These pants are aimed at men who need a versatile, hard-wearing pant for tactical use, military training, hiking, fishing, motorcycling, or day-to-day outdoor work. The mix of tactical pockets and stretch makes them well suited to users who carry gear and need freedom of movement without bulky legs.
Shoppers who want very stretchy, athleisure-style pants or who require formal office trousers should look elsewhere; likewise those needing full waterproofing for prolonged wet-weather use should consider a dedicated rain pant instead.

Specifications
| Brand | Tesla Gears |
| Model | CQR Flex Utility Pants |
| Fabric | Tac-Stretch water resistant ripstop |
| Waist | Comfort elastic adjustable waistband |
| Construction | Reinforced double-stitching |
| Pocketing | Quick utility tactical pockets, some mesh-lined |
| Intended use | Tactical, hiking, climbing, fishing, motorcycling, outdoor work |
